Consistency of caregivers is an important aspect of a developmentally appropriate child care program. Discuss what directors can do to retain staff.

Answer to Question 1

Be a strong advocate for adequate salaries. Plan training sessions to improve skills. Allow opportunities for staff to discuss problems or voice frustrations. Include them in decisions that affect them.

Over time, chronic hepatitis B virus and hepatitis C virus infections can progress to advanced liver disease, liver failure, and hepatocellular carcinoma. Unlike other forms, more than 80% of hepatitis C infections become chronic and lead to liver disease. When combined with hepatitis B, hepatitis C now accounts for 75% percent of all cases of liver disease around the world. Liver failure caused by hepatitis C is now leading cause of liver transplants in the United States.

Walt Disney helped combat malaria by making an animated film in 1943 called The Winged Scourge. This short film starred the seven dwarfs and taught children that mosquitos transmit malaria, which is a very bad disease. It advocated the killing of mosquitos to stop the disease.
